Webmail: "ERROR: Could not append message to Sent Messages"

When sending a newly composed messages, Webmail responds with "ERROR: Could not append message to Sent Messages. Server responded: Permission denied". The message IS actually sent but not entered into the Sent Messages box.

In addition a second message is displayed: "ERROR: Bad or malformed request. Server responded: Unrecognized command"

Check that the admin user you have set in
impad.conf is not also the name of any group (user group) on your server.

In 10.4,
cat /etc/imapd.conf | grep

should return:

admins: cyrusimap

Also, when logged in via webmail, check the "Folders"option, at the bottom of the page, and unsubscribe to any shared folders that should not be listed there.

As I have indicated above, the default in 10.4 is "cyrusimap" and not "admin"

If the name there is instead "admin" it should not be, and even then I advise against using "admin" as the actual account name for your main admin account.

If you are attempting to use cyradm, then your configration is not as it should be.
